Alejandro Garnacho nears Chelsea exit as Aston Villa plot loan move for unwanted star

Standard Sport understands the winger is in line to leave Stamford Bridge on a season-long loan move, which would likely include a conditional obligation for the Villans to sign the player permanently next summer.Talks between the clubs are now advancing and there is an increasing level of confidence that the deal can be finalised and go through.The Blues put Garnacho up for sale last month. The club's asking price was £43million for the 21-year-old.On the move: Alejandro GarnachoGettyChelsea only signed Garnacho from Manchester United last summer, for £40m, but are already plotting his exit and believe a loan with obligation to Villa can be the solution.Meanwhile, Xabi Alonso’s side have added John Stones to their shortlist of centre-back candidates, alongside the likes of Como’s Jacobo Ramon. The 32-year-old became a free agent after leaving Manchester City on July 1 and played a significant role for England as they finished third at the World Cup in Canada, Mexico and the United States, registering their best finish since 1966.The central defender, if signed, would be the second defensive acquisition of Alonso’s reign, with Chelsea having already signed versatile wing-back Marco Palestra from Seria A side Atalanta in a deal worth around £47m.
